加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0411zz.cn/)- 文字识别、智能机器人、智能内容、自然语言处理、图像分析!
当前位置: 首页 > 云计算 > 正文

云原生部署:自动化弹性扩容实战解析

发布时间:2025-12-06 15:21:12 所属栏目:云计算 来源:DaWei
导读:   在云原生环境中,自动化弹性扩容策略是确保应用高可用性和资源高效利用的关键。随着业务流量的波动,系统需要能够根据实际负载自动调整计算资源,避免资源浪费或性能瓶颈。  实现自动

  在云原生环境中,自动化弹性扩容策略是确保应用高可用性和资源高效利用的关键。随着业务流量的波动,系统需要能够根据实际负载自动调整计算资源,避免资源浪费或性能瓶颈。


  实现自动化弹性扩容的核心在于监控和响应机制。通过部署监控工具,如Prometheus和Grafana,可以实时收集系统的CPU、内存、网络等关键指标。这些数据为弹性决策提供了基础依据。


  Kubernetes作为主流的容器编排平台,提供了Horizontal Pod Autoscaler(HPA)功能,可以根据预设的指标动态调整Pod数量。同时,Vertical Pod Autoscaler(VPA)则用于调整单个Pod的资源分配,进一步优化资源使用效率。


  除了Kubernetes自身的能力,还可以结合云服务商提供的弹性伸缩服务,如AWS Auto Scaling或阿里云弹性伸缩。这些服务通常与云平台深度集成,能够更精准地响应负载变化并管理底层资源。


  为了确保弹性策略的有效性,需要设置合理的阈值和冷却时间。过高的触发阈值可能导致响应延迟,而过低的阈值则可能引发不必要的资源扩展,增加成本。


  在实施过程中,建议进行压力测试和模拟演练,验证弹性策略在不同场景下的表现。这有助于发现潜在问题,并在正式上线前进行优化。


此图形AI生成,仅供参考

  日志和告警系统的建设同样重要。当弹性扩缩容发生时,及时的通知和详细的日志记录可以帮助运维人员快速定位问题,提升整体系统的稳定性。


  最终,自动化弹性扩容不仅是技术实现的问题,还需要结合业务需求和成本控制进行综合规划。通过持续优化策略,企业可以实现更高效的云原生部署和运维管理。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章